Oh I don't think so.  Within a year we have obtained the ability to produce
ICC profile based soft proofs of any workflow - QTR, Paul Roark, or BO.  QTR
has jumped even further into a fully colour managed workflow.  There are
still many vagaries to the technology and the fact that not all users have
the equipment to do their own proofs etc and so must rely on profiles
generated by other users introduces further variance.  And at the heart of
it all is a decently profiled monitor.  But the biggest issue seems to be
the lack of adoption of what's already available....
